#EndSars: Don't blame Akufo -Addo for Buhari's incompetence – Medikal

Ghanaian Rapper Medikal, born Samuel Adu Frimpong, has asked persons criticising the President of the Republic of Ghana on his silence about the End Sars protest in Nigeria to give the first gentleman a break.

End Special Anti-Robbery Squad (End SARS) or #EndSARS is a decentralized social movement against police brutality in Nigeria.

The protesters are calling for an end to the Special Anti-Robbery Squad (SARS), a controversial unit of the Nigerian Police Force with a long record of abuses.

The protesters have shared both stories and video evidence of how members of SARS engaged in kidnapping, murder, theft, rape, torture, unlawful arrests, humiliation, unlawful detention, extrajudicial killings, and extortion in Nigeria

Critics have called out the President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o , who happens to be the Chairman for the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S) for failing to talk about the #EndSARS protest in Nigeria.

Reacting to the issue in a tweet, Ghanian Rapper Medikal said the silence of President Akufo Addo does not mean that he is doing nothing behind closed doors.

“The Ghanaian President ein silence on social media no dey mean say he is doing nothing behind closed doors. May be he is, who knows? How many times wonna President address the nation during the COVID/ Lockdown period in Ghana? Severally ! don’t blame Nana for Buhari’s incompetence,” Medikal said in a tweet.
